P Diddy's initial foray into the music scene was as an intern at Uptown Records, where he quickly rose through the ranks due to his talent and work ethic. His ability to identify and nurture musical talent became apparent as he worked with artists such as Mary J. Blige and Jodeci. Despite facing setbacks, including his eventual departure from Uptown Records, P Diddy's resilience and vision led him to establish his own record label, Bad Boy Entertainment, in 1993.

From a young age, P Diddy showed a keen interest in music and entrepreneurship. His early life was marked by personal challenges, but these experiences shaped his determination to succeed. He attended Howard University, where he studied business administration, but left before completing his degree to pursue a career in the music industry. This bold decision was the first of many that would define his career.

Beyond music, P Diddy's influence extends to fashion, where he has played a pivotal role in shaping trends and styles. His clothing line, Sean John, has become synonymous with urban fashion, combining streetwear aesthetics with high-end design. Through his fashion endeavors, P Diddy has elevated the status of hip-hop culture, bringing it into the mainstream and challenging perceptions of style and identity.
